Many users have successfully installed ProShow Producer 9.0 on Windows 10 and Windows 11. However, because the activation servers for Photodex are offline, you cannot activate a new license digitally.
Unlike a standard video editor, ProShow Producer was laser-focused on creating sophisticated and dynamic slideshows. Its purpose is to take your photos, video clips, and music and turn them into a completely customized, professional video presentation. It was the tool of choice for photographers to present their portfolios, for businesses to create impactful promotional content, and for individuals to produce high-quality tributes and family movies that went far beyond a simple photo album.
The software is defunct, unsupported, and unsafe for new production work in 2022. While it remains a fondly remembered tool for its keyframe-based slideshow editing, users must migrate to modern alternatives like DaVinci Resolve or MAGIX Photostory. Attempting to use the 2018 version on new hardware or Windows 11 will lead to crashes, security vulnerabilities, and inability to activate or reinstall.
